About Luís Pinto

Luís Pinto is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Medicine, Organic Chemistry, Molecular Biology and Infectious Diseases, having authored 30 papers that have together received 497 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(7 papers), Horticultural and Viticultural Research (7 papers), Edible Oils Quality and Analysis (5 papers),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(4 papers),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(4 papers), Microbial infections and disease research (3 papers),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(3 papers) and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Medicine (176 citations), Clinical Biochemistry (75 citations), Pollution (124 citations), Endocrinology (52 citations) and Microbiology (45 citations). Luís Pinto has collaborated with scholars based in Portugal, Spain and Brazil. Frequent co-authors include Gilberto Igrejas, Patrícia Poeta, Hajer Radhouani, Alexandre Gonçalves, Cármen Torres, Céline Coelho, Jorge Rodrigues, Manuel Ângelo Rodrigues, Cátia Brito and Carlos M. Correia.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Proteomics, OMICS A Journal of Integrative Biology, European Food Research and Technology, Horticulturae and Journal of Food Science and Technology.
